HYDROTIDE II

Recording survey tide gauge

HYDROTIDE II is a purpose designed recording tide gauge for long term monitoring of tidal activity in unattended remote locations.

 HYDROTIDE II replaces the extremely successful HYDROTIDE unit, and is manufactured by RBR in Canada. It incorporates all of the same features, including on site user calibration that made the original system so popular. But with added features such as user replaceable batteries, external power option, simple telemetry interface, Windows software, increased memory capacity and a wave processing option.

 Changes in pressure due to changes in head of water are detected by a semiconductor strain gauge transducer.  These changes are recorded at pre-set intervals within the data loggers solid state memory.  The pressure transducer is manufactured from titanium and stainless steel and suitable for long term immersion in most liquids.  The transducer is connected to the logger via a single small diameter cable which also contains a micro bore pipe and thus allows atmospheric pressure to be applied to the rear of the transducers diaphragm automatically.  This provides accurate and calibration free compensation for changes in ambient atmospheric pressure.

 The HYDROTIDE II data logger is housed within a rugged, water tight aluminium enclosure.  Connections are made via water tight connectors.  Power is provided by four standard alkaline C cells in water tight holders.  This provides sufficient power to operate the unit for up to five  years.  The user has a wide selection of sampling regimes which are preset into the logger using simple Windows software.  The instrument may store up to 2,400,000 readings in its 8 MB flash memory. The HYDROTIDE II data logger is programmed to make a number of samples at 4Hz, by averaging these over an operator selectable averaging period, wave motion is filtered out.  The average depth value in metres is recorded and time/date stamped.  Corrections for water density can be applied by calibrating in situ if required.  Calibration constants are stored within the logger, and field calibration can be undertaken without deadweight testers by using the calibration constants provided with each sensor.

 The Windows software allows loggers to be set up and data downloaded and viewed as a simple graph.  Once downloaded, data may be archived to disk, printed as a time series, graphed, or exported to spread sheets and data bases.

 HYDROTIDE II is supplied complete with 1 bar (10 metre) pressure transducer with 15 metres vented cable, data cable, software, operating manual and aluminium transit case. Other ranges and cable lengths on request.

SPECIFICATIONS:-

Sensor:                         Semiconductor strain gauge with atmospheric venting via pipe in cable 

Range:                          0 - 10m with automatic atmospheric compensation as standard (other ranges to order)   

Accuracy:                     Overall system accuracy (linearity, hysterisis etc) typ 0.1% FS.  0.06% F.S option 

Resolution:                    <0.001% F.S 

Clock Accuracy:             +/- 32 seconds per year 

Update period :              Selectable in 1 second intervals from 10 seconds to 100 hours 

Averaging period :          Selectable in second increments (each sample 0.75 seconds approx.) 

Memory:                       8MB Flash 2,400,000 records (averaged values) 

Power supply:                4 off C size Alkaline batteries 

External Power:             12V 5mA (sample) 20 uA sleep 

Battery endurance:         5 years typ 

Communications:           RS-232  /485 to PC or telemetry 

Download speed:           Cable:- 115,000 samples/minute 

Construction:                 IP 65 aluminium case with venting membrane 

Dimensions:                  148mm x 75mm x 250mm  

Weight:                         (logger) 1.5 kg

Software:

HYDROTIDE II uses integrated Windows software. Features include display of battery volts, real-time mode, entry of calibration constants, two point calibration, and interactive setup complete with estimates of battery life and memory capacity.
